 
                            Monsoon Forecast: Due to Cyclone Montha, warnings have been issued for heavy rain and thunderstorms across several states. According to the Meteorological Department, the weather has changed dramatically in several states. Temperatures in Himachal Pradesh have dropped below freezing. Winter has arrived in North India, and people are now experiencing extreme cold in the mornings and evenings. Rain continues in Bihar and Uttar Pradesh, as well as in several other states across North India, due to weather changes caused by Cyclone Montha. The Meteorological Department has issued an alert for this.
Heavy Rains Expected in These States
The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ued a warning of heavy rains across several states on October 31st. A heavy rain alert has been issued for the eastern districts of Uttar Pradesh until Friday, October 31st. Additionally, heavy rains are expected in many areas of Maharashtra, Gujarat, Konkan, and Goa on October 31st.
Light rain, strong winds, and thunderstorms are also forecast in these districts. Heavy rain alerts have also been issued for Kerala, Telangana, Yanam, coastal Andhra Pradesh, Karnataka, Rayalaseema, and Tamil Nadu on October 31st. Rain is also expected in Manipur, Meghalaya, Arunachal Pradesh, Tripura, Mizoram, and Nagaland today.
Light rain, thunderstorms, and lightning are also expected here. Heavy rain is expected in Madhya Pradesh, Bihar, Jharkhand, West Bengal, Chhattisgarh, Odisha, and the Andaman and Nicobar Islands on October 31st.
Rajasthan Weather Update
According to the Meteorological Department, Udaipur, Kota divisions, and surrounding districts will remain cloudy, with light rain expected over the next four to five days. However, in other parts, the weather will remain dry in most districts from October 31st.
Rain alert on October 31
A heavy rain warning has been issued for many areas of Bihar on Friday, October 31st. The Meteorological Department has issued an orange alert for rain in Sitamarhi, Madhubani, Supaul, Araria, and Kishanganj. A yellow alert has been issued for other districts in the state. Heavy rain and thunderstorms are expected in West Champaran, Muzaffarpur, Darbhanga, Samastipur, Madhepura, Saharsa, Purnia, and Katihar districts today.
